Kim Kardashian defends festive post after grandmother's death

Kim Kardashian has addressed criticism after sharing holiday photographs shortly after the death of her grandmother, Mary Jo “MJ” Campbell. The reality star and businesswoman faced questions over the timing of the Instagram post, which was captioned “lake life” and appeared within the same hour that her mother, Kris Jenner, announced the family’s loss.

Responding to comments, Kardashian explained that the images had been scheduled before her grandmother’s passing. She wrote: “This post was scheduled a few days ago before we lost MJ, so its timing came right alongside her passing. I’ve been by my mom and grandma’s side this past week, and my heart is completely with my family right now. We love and miss her so deeply, and in the days ahead, we’ll be focusing on celebrating her beautiful life.”

She later paid tribute to her grandmother in a separate post, describing her as “my best friend, my gossip buddy, my forever twin” and praising her as a “hardworking businesswoman” who gave Kardashian her first job at a store in San Diego. She added: “You truly were the matriarch of our family, and your love is woven into all of us. I know you’re at peace now. Give Papa Harry, Aunt Karen, and my dad a hug for me. YOU ARE THE BEST OF US!!!”

In announcing her mother’s death, Kris Jenner said her heart was “broken into a million pieces” and paid tribute to MJ as “the heart of our family”. She wrote: “My mom was the heart of our family. She taught me everything that truly matters… to love your family fiercely, to be kind, to show up for the people you love, and to never take a single moment together for granted.”

Mary Jo Campbell, who was 91, appeared in the original Keeping Up With The Kardashians series from 2007 to 2021 and also featured in the follow-up series, The Kardashians. Her death was confirmed by Kris Jenner in a statement that thanked her mother for “every sacrifice she made” and every “piece of wisdom” she shared.
